Even in the era of modern integral-field spectrographs, the Fabry-Perot interferometer (FPI) provides a unique combination of a large field of view, high spectral resolution, and detailed image sampling that are important to study the ionized ISM in galaxies including the diffuse ionized gas (DIG). We present results of our recent studies of nearby star-forming galaxies taken with high- and low-resolution (tunablefilter) FPIs at the 6-m SAO RAS telescope and 2.5-m SAI MSU telescope. The relation between the ionized-gas velocity dispersion and forbidden to Balmer line ratio is used for diagnostics of shock fronts in the outflow matter. Also, the list of planetary nebula candidates in the NGC 3077 galaxy was compiled based on our tunable-filter observations.
